Can anyone tell me what "Cross-Platform Connectivity" is? I can't find the answer I need on google!
Robb
Sep 2 2007, 11:16 AM
Basically connecting two different types of machines together.
An example would be a mainly windows based network, but it also has a Mac attached to it. They all share the one printer.
